  • ReadyLIFT offers an all-new leveling kit solution to enhance the stance of the 2021-2024 Ford F-150 Raptor Gen 3 trucks. The 66-27150 kit provides 1.5" of front leveling lift. For the newest Ford Raptor trucks, we deployed our renowned, indestructible CNC machined 6061-T6 billet Aluminum construction with an anodized black finish to match the OE suspension components.  The leveling kit is laser engraved with the ReadyLIFT logo for a clean crisp look that properly levels these Raptor trucks.  These new Raptor leveling solutions incorporate top-quality rugged construction worthy of this new high-performance pickup truck and deliver an awesome neutral stance sure to delight all Raptor fans.

    Tire Size Note: ReadyLIFT wheel and tire fitment recommendations are typically based on Wheel Pros wheels and Nitto tires. Due to product differences among tire manufacturers, tire specifications and dimensions including, but limited to, overall diameter, rolling diameter, tread width, aspect ratio, lug pattern, sidewall construction and inflation pressure, will vary meaningfully by tire and wheel manufacturer. Every tire and wheel combination should be test fit prior to installation. Consult your local installer to learn more about the right tire fitment for your application.

    Ride Quality Note: When lifting a vehicle and installing aftermarket wheels and tires, a tire manufacturer's construction and material quality can alter vehicle ride quality. When increasing a vehicle wheel and tire size, most larger aftermarket truck and SUV tires are 10-ply (or more) E tires compared to typical OEM 6-ply C tires. This more rigid sidewall construction increases the perception of suspension stiffness often described as ride harshness. The ride, handling, traction, noise, fuel economy, and wear differences between All-Season, All-Terrain, Mud-Terrain, or Trail-Terrain type tires can be significant. Please take into account tire and wheel choice will generally have a meaningful impact on the ride & handling experience.

    INSTALLATION ALIGNMENT NOTE:  Your vehicle may require alignment after product installation.  You may incur additional costs to align the vehicle.

     

    INSTALLATION HEADLAMP AIM NOTE:  In addition to your vehicle alignment, for your safety and others, it is necessary to check and adjust your vehicle headlamps for proper aim and alignment after product installation.  You may incur additional costs to adjust the headlamp system.

     

    INSTALLATION ADVANCED DRIVER ASSISTANCE SYSTEMS (ADAS) NOTE:  If your vehicle is equipped with active or passive safety/collision monitoring and/or assistance/avoidance systems including, but not limited to, camera- or radar/sonar-based systems, check and adjust your vehicle’s systems for proper aim and function after product installation.   In some instances, your vehicle may require OEM dealer service tools and factory-trained technicians to re-calibrate ADAS.  You may incur additional costs to adjust ADAS systems.
